On #NationalCancerSurvivorsDay, we celebrate all of the milestones our Tackle Kids Cancer MVPs (Most Valiant Patients) achieve thanks to the generous support of donors like you. From ringing the bell to signify the end of treatment to celebrating birthdays and graduations, your contributions help ensure our MVPs experience these precious life moments. #TKCMVP Darius's story is a powerful testament to the resilience we celebrate today.At 17, Darius was a typical high school senior, busy with college applications and rehearsals for his school musical.As Thanksgiving 2023 approached, what seemed like exhaustion led to an emergency room visit that changed everything. Darius was diagnosed with acute lymphocytic leukemia (ALL). "I remember thinking, ‘this is the end of my childhood,’" he said. "But I also knew I was going to get through this.”From the beginning, the team at Jersey Shore University Medical Center provided expert and compassionate care. Music became Darius's escape. Funding from Tackle Kids Cancer made special moments possible, like when a music therapist surprised him by playing his favorite songs on her violin during a chemotherapy session.Through it all, Darius persevered. He made it to his prom and walked at his high school graduation. "It wasn’t easy,” he said. “But those moments mattered. They reminded me that cancer didn’t take everything.”Now 19, Darius rang the bell to signify finishing treatment and is a student at Seton Hall University. He is studying nursing, inspired by the nurses who cared for him. His mother, Tara, emphasizes the impact of support from programs like Tackle Kids Cancer. “You’re not just giving money. You’re giving a parent the ability to sit beside their child, to hold their hand.
